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) Cost in Snoqualmie, WA
The cost of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Snoqualmie, WA. Here are some estimated price ranges for common scenarios: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Restoration and rep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| Scope of work, materials needed |
| Mold remediation |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of mold growth, size of affected area |
| Dehumidification and ventilation |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, duration of treatment |
| Disinfection and sanitizing |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of surfaces |
| Structural drying and rep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|

Q: How do I prevent water damage in the future?
A: There are several steps you can take to prevent water damage in the future. Regular maintenance of your home’s plumbing and appliances, keeping an eye out for signs of leaks or water damage, and having a plan in place in case of an emergency can all help to reduce the risk of water damage.
